Class: Nylas::Types::ModelType
Overview
Type for attributes that are persisted in the API as a hash but exposed in ruby as a particular Model or Model-like thing.

#cast(value) ⇒ Object
60
61
62
63
64
65
66
|
# File 'lib/nylas/types.rb', line 60
def cast(value)
return model.new if value.nil?
return value if already_cast?(value)
return model.new(**actual_attributes(value)) if value.respond_to?(:key?)
raise TypeError, "Unable to cast #{value} to a #{model}"
end
